Lubricants for sewing threads
For the lubrication in dye bath and when it is needed liquid lubrication for sewing yarns, we offer our oils and LUBRIFIL products. In the finishing of dyed yarns, the application of LUBRIFIL allows the homogeneous distribution of lubricant on the yarn surface, facilitating the yarn sliding when it works with demanding applications.


For sewing thread cone winders, with lubricant recirculation pump or with application by tray and kiss roll system, LUBRIFIL offers optimal results when it comes to coating the yarn with a thin and homogeneous layer of lubricant.
For the oiling of the yarns we offer self-emulsifying oils YARNOIL-WLE y YARNOIL-WLE/A,with antistatic and antioxidant additives. It is used in the yarn lubrication with contact roller or capillary systems (lubricating plates and felts).
Lubricants for sewing threads
TYPE | APPLICATIONS |
---|---|
LUBRIFIL - FLV | Lubricant emulsion of paraffinic wax and silicone compounds, with softening and antistatic additives. Emulsifiable. For the lubrication of filaments and cotton yarns, synthetics and blends. For cold application, in machines with lubricant recirculation and exhaustion in dyeing bath. . |
LUBRIFIL CLV 80 | Lubricant of paraffinic wax and silicones, with softening and antistatic additives. Emulsifiable. For the lubrication of cotton yarns, filaments and fiber blend yarns. Solid presentation. For hot application with tray and contact roller or exhaustion in dyeing bath, after dilution. |
YARN OIL WLE | Composition of purified paraffinic base oils with emulsifying, antistatic and antioxidant additives. For cold application, in systems without lubricant circulation or with lubricant pumping. Application by contact or by capillarity. Totally emulsifiable. |
YARN OIL WLE/A | Composition of purified paraffinic base oils with emulsifying, antistatic and antioxidant additives. For cold application, in systems without lubricant circulation or with lubricant pumping. Application by contact or by capillarity. Totally emulsifiable Lower lubricant load, lower viscosity and ease of extraction of the textile substrate. |
